begin process at 2012 05 29 04:56:07
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Javascript / DHTML / Ajax

 > 

CSS

 > 

Général

 > 

demand de correction d'un code


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

demand de correction d'un code

samedi 23 juillet 2011 à 14:15:43 | demand de correction d'un code

lyamcarter

Bonjour, c'est mon premier message ici. Je suis novice, et j'essaye de faire une page web dans laquelle il y a un tableau.
Je souhaite en cliquant sur lien 1 afficher un texte 1 dans une cellule du tableau
Ensuite en cliquant sur le lien 2 le texte 2 s'affiche dans la même cellule du tableau.

J'ai reussi a afficher le texte 1 en cliquant sur le lien 1
Mais quand je clic sur le lien 2 le texte s'affiche mais le texte 1 ne s'en va pas. Comment puis je faire ? voici le code

<Head>
<script>
function visibilite(thingId)
{
var targetElement;
targetElement = document.getElementById(thingId) ;
if (targetElement.style.display == "none")
{
targetElement.style.display = "" ;
} else {
targetElement.style.display = "none" ;
}
}
</script>

</head>

<body>

<a href="javascript:visibilite('divid1');"> lien 1 </a>
<a href="javascript:visibilite('divid2');"> lien 2 </a>

<div id="divid1" style="display:none;">
Texte 1
</div>


<div id="divid2" style="display:none;">
Texte 2
</div>

samedi 23 juillet 2011 à 21:09:37 | Re : demand de correction d'un code

mikeyjoy

Salut lyam,
Bienvenue dans la programmation JS .
Voilà un code qui peut t'être utile. Je ne sais pas exactement quand tu veux que tout les textes disparaissent. Mais tu pourras certainement faire quelque chose avec tout ça.
a+

Code HTML :
<html>
<head>
<script type="text/javascript">
	function visibilite(thingId, texte){ 
		var targetElement ; 
		targetElement = document.getElementById(thingId) ; 
		if (targetElement.style.display == "none"){ 
			targetElement.style.display = "" ; 
		}
		targetElement.innerHTML = texte ;
	} 
</script>
</head>

<body>
<a href="javascript:visibilite('divid1', 'monTexte 1');"> lien 1 </a> 
<a href="javascript:visibilite('divid1', 'monTexte 2');"> lien 2 </a> 

<div id="divid1" style="display:none;"> 
</div> 

</body>
</html>
dimanche 24 juillet 2011 à 10:24:28 | Re : demand de correction d'un code

lyamcarter

Bonjour, et merci . Le probleme est eaxctement le meme que moi avec ton code . c'est adire que lie texte 1 ne s'en va pas quand je clic sur un autre lien
lundi 25 juillet 2011 à 16:54:53 | Re : demand de correction d'un code

lyamcarter

Je veux bien d'un coup de main
jeudi 28 juillet 2011 à 09:12:28 | Re : demand de correction d'un code

lyamcarter

Personnes pour m'aider?
jeudi 28 juillet 2011 à 11:35:17 | Re : demand de correction d'un code

coucou747

Administrateur CodeS-SourceS
Bonjour,

Il suffit de mémoriser le dernier ID affiché dans une variable globale, pour pouvoir le cacher ensuite.

Peut-tu tenter de le faire et revenir en cas de soucis ?
jeudi 28 juillet 2011 à 13:10:53 | Re : demand de correction d'un code

lyamcarter

Bonjour, merci a vous d'avoir répondu. Je dois dire que c'est du chinois pour moi.
doit y avoir un hide quelque chose , mais je suis incapable de transcrire ce que vous me dite
mardi 2 août 2011 à 20:03:01 | Re : demand de correction d'un code

lyamcarter

Personne ? Sa fait trois semaine que je galère. Même en cherchant sur google tout les exemples sont pas bon.
mercredi 3 août 2011 à 10:54:33 | Re : demand de correction d'un code

girardcimpa

Bonjour
Peut être quelque chose dans ce style

Code HTML :
<Head>
<script>
function visibilite(thingId)
{
var targetElement;
targetElement = document.getElementById(thingId) ;

var oldtarget;
oldtarget = document.getElementById(cacher);
oldtarget.style.display == "none"
oldtarget.value = targetElement.value 

if (targetElement.style.display == "none")
{
targetElement.style.display = "" ;
} else {
targetElement.style.display = "none" ;
}
}
</script>

</head>

<body>

<input type="hidden" id="cacher" value="" />

<a href="javascript:visibilite('divid1');"> lien 1 </a>
<a href="javascript:visibilite('divid2');"> lien 2 </a>

<div id="divid1" style="display:none;">
Texte 1
</div>
<div id="divid2" style="display:none;">
Texte 2
</div> 

mercredi 3 août 2011 à 11:06:04 | Re : demand de correction d'un code

lyamcarter

Merci mais le texte ne s'affiche plus du tout cette fois quand on clic sur les lien

1 2

Cette discussion est classée dans : code, texte, lien, color, targetelement


Répondre à ce message

Sujets en rapport avec ce message

transformer un lien en texte [ par Jarod1980 ] Bonjour,J'aimerais savoir comment transformer un texte ou une image en lien sans utiliser la commande doRichEditCommand('CreateLink');En fait, ce que Code pour faire apparaître un texte en dessous d'un lien [ par DarKent ] Bonjour,Je sais pas si c'est là que je doit faire ma demande.... Je cherche un code pour faire apparaître un texte en dessous d'un lien. La page princ Code Lien [ par TOONIE ] Bonsoir,J'essaye de créer un lien avec un code un peu moderne (en tout cas pour le débutant que je suis, je trouve cela moderne. !), et ça ne fonction Afficher du texte en cliquant sur un lien [ par leclem ] Bonjour, je suis actuellement a la recherche d'un code javascript permettant, au click sur un lien, de faire apparaitre du texte HTML en décalant les Afficher du texte en cliquant sur un lien [ par leclem ] Bonjour, je suis actuellement a la recherche d'un code javascript permettant, au click sur un lien, de faire apparaitre du texte HTML en décalant les probleme code lien tableau [ par ju0123456789 ] Hello !J'ai un problème avec un code, je voudrais que, quando n clique dans une case du tableau, l'url destinée s'ouvre dans une nouvelle fenetre, voi Modifier la balise herf [ par wassimbik ] Bonjour à tous J'ai utilisé Code : JavaScriptdo Affichage de texte suivant un click [ par Arnauti ] Bonjour a tous, Après avoir chercher sur le net et sur ce site je n'ai pas trouvé de réponse a ma question.En effet, je suis a la recherche d'un scrip Code HTML d'une sélection [ par jdmcreator ] Bonjour, Après plusieurs heures de recherches infructueuses sur Google, je pose ici ma question. J'aimerais savoir si on peut récupérer le code HTML Connaitre le tag d'un champs suivant son ID [ par Divinity78180 ] Bonjour, J'aimerais savoir s'il est possible de connaitre le tag de l'objet qu'on sélectionne avec "getElementById". [b]Exemple :[/b] [code=html] [


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 1,108 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ales